Today, I'm joined by Mark Alexander, a good friend of mine and the proud founder of Property118, a platform for landlord tax planning, property investment news, and discussions in the UK.
With an impressive 36 years of experience in property finance, tax, and law, Mark joins us to share some incredible insights. In our conversation, we delve into:
- The story behind his incredibly successful lending company and the subsequent creation of Property118
- Mark's triumphant legal battles against mortgage companies
- His experience managing a portfolio of over a hundred properties and the reasons behind his strategic reduction
- The long-term tax implications of property portfolio development
- Understanding the concept of a family investment company
- The importance of tax planning
- Mark's invaluable advice for property investors navigating the current market's challenges.
- The future of the Private Rented Sector (PRS) and the evolving landscape of property investments.
